The utility model provides an automatic overturning garbage box, belonging to the technical field of garbage disposal. The automatic overturning garbage box comprises a bottom plate, a telescopic support column is fixedly installed on the upper surface of the bottom plate, and a limited support block is fixedly arranged on the top of the telescopic support column. A first support rod is fixedly connected to the top of the position support block, a motor is fixedly installed on one side of the first support rod, and a rotating shaft is fixedly installed at the output end of the motor; Drive the rotating shaft to rotate and take up the conveyor belt. As the conveyor belt is continuously retracted, the garbage bin is lifted up. After the garbage collection is completed, press the belt release switch. When the garbage bin returns to the original position, the motor automatically turns off. The waste transfer work is completed, avoiding the contact between the staff and the waste, and will not cause secondary pollution. The waste dumping is convenient and fast, saving time and effort, improving work efficiency and reducing the labor intensity of staff.

In the figure: 1. a base plate; 2. a telescopic support column; 3. a limiting supporting block; 4. a first support bar; 5. a motor; 6. a rotating shaft; 7. a conveyor belt; 8. a support pillar; 9. a rod is retracted and released; 10. a second support bar; 11. a support frame; 12. a dustbin; 13. a first stopper; 14. a second limiting block; 15. a tape retracting switch; 16. a tape releasing switch; 17. and screwing the block.

Referring to fig. 1-7, the present invention provides the following technical solutions: the utility model provides an automatic upset dustbin, comprising a base plate 1, bottom plate 1's last fixed surface installs flexible support column 2, the fixed limit support 3 that is provided with in top of flexible support column 2, the first bracing piece 4 of top fixedly connected with of limit support block 3, a side fixed mounting of first bracing piece 4 has motor 5, motor 5's output fixed mounting has pivot 6, the lateral surface transmission of pivot 6 is connected with conveyer belt 7, the medial surface of conveyer belt 7 is from last to having connected with support column 8 and receive and release pole 9 down in proper order the transmission, a side fixedly connected with second bracing piece 10 of limit support block 3, the lateral surface rotation of second bracing piece 10 is connected with support frame 11, the medial surface fixedly connected with dustbin 12 of support frame 11.
In the embodiment of the utility model, through the matching arrangement of the telescopic supporting column 2, the limit supporting block 3, the first supporting rod 4, the motor 5, the rotating shaft 6, the conveying belt 7, the supporting column 8, the retracting and releasing rod 9, the second supporting rod 10, the first limiting block 13, the second limiting block 14, the belt retracting switch 15, the belt releasing switch 16 and the screwing block 17, the height of the telescopic supporting column 2 can be adjusted, the garbage collecting vehicle is suitable for garbage collecting vehicles with different heights, the practicability is strong, when the utility model works, the belt retracting switch 15 is pressed down, the motor 5 is started, the motor 5 drives the rotating shaft 6 to rotate to retract the conveying belt 7, the garbage can 12 is lifted along with the continuous retraction of the conveying belt 7, the rotating shaft 6 also plays the limiting role at the moment, the garbage can 12 reaches a certain height, the motor 6 is automatically closed, the garbage in the garbage can is poured into the garbage collecting vehicle under the action of, according to the garbage can, the belt switch 16 is put down, when the garbage can 12 returns to the original position, the motor 5 is automatically closed, the garbage transferring work is completed, the contact between workers and garbage is avoided, the secondary pollution cannot be caused, the garbage can is poured conveniently and quickly, time and labor are saved, the working efficiency is improved, and the labor intensity of the workers is reduced.
Specifically, one end of the conveyor belt 7 is fixed on the outer side surface of the support column 8, and the other end of the conveyor belt 7 is fixed on the outer side surface of the take-up and pay-off rod 9.
In this embodiment: through the arrangement of the conveyor belt 7, the automatic overturning dustbin is convenient for the collection and release of the conveyor belt 7, and the working efficiency is improved.
Specifically, a first limiting block 13 is arranged on the outer side surface of the rotating shaft 6, and second limiting blocks 14 are respectively arranged at two ends of the retracting rod 9.
In this embodiment: through the arrangement of the first limiting block 13 and the second limiting block 14, the automatic overturning dustbin can receive and release the conveyor belt 7 within a certain range, and the working continuity is guaranteed.
Specifically, a belt retracting switch 15 is disposed on one side surface of the first support rod 4, and a belt releasing switch 16 is disposed on one side of the belt retracting switch 15.
In this embodiment: through the arrangement of the belt retracting switch 15 and the belt releasing switch 16, the automatic overturning dustbin is convenient for controlling the retracting and releasing work of the transmission belt, and the working efficiency is improved.
Specifically, the second support bar 10 is fixedly connected with two screwing blocks 17 through bolts, and the number of the screwing blocks 17 is two.
In this embodiment: through the setting of the screwing block 17, the automatic overturning dustbin is more stable and convenient for dumping garbage.
Specifically, the dustbin 12 is made of aluminum alloy.
In this embodiment: through the arrangement of the dustbin 12, the automatic overturning dustbin is light and durable, convenient to transport and use and capable of saving energy.
